We are hiring Partnerships Director

Sell the No.1 iGaming media brand on LinkedIn, on a warm book of 100+ clients, for uncapped monthly commission.

Bartosz Hrydziuszko by Bartosz Hrydziuszko
July 20, 2026
in Announcements

Home » We are hiring Partnerships Director

Remote, anywhere in Europe or North America. Contractor.

TGE is the No.1 iGaming media brand on LinkedIn. In the last 90 days our content reached 1.5 million unique members, all organic. Single posts hit 70,000 to 100,000 people off one image, more than the attendance of any industry conference. Our industry lives online, and so do we. We put the numbers behind that in one place: Where iGaming B2B Buyers Actually Are in 2026.

Where iGaming B2B Buyers Actually Are in 2026: The Data

We’re part of a wider iGaming media network that collaborates across brands, with more launching.

We want one person to run commercial sales across TGE’s products. You inherit the book on day one: 100+ existing clients and warm leads, plus 1 to 3 new inbound every week. Close them, rebook them when their campaigns end, grow the accounts.

What you’re selling

Real exposure to iGaming decision-makers where they spend their day: the LinkedIn feed. Market reports built from traffic data, regulator filings and company results. Written company and launch stories. Banner placements on theigaming.eu. Sponsored debates and polls that operators, suppliers and executives argue about in the comments.

We don’t sell backlinks or domain rating. iGaming B2B buyers don’t open Google to find their next platform or payments provider. They hear about it through networking and the feed. The products match that.

We don’t syndicate press releases. The same text and image pushed to ten publications gets treated as duplicate content by LinkedIn and buried. Every TGE piece is written by our editorial team and made to be read.

Who you’ll sell to

  • B2C iGaming operators
  • B2B suppliers: casino games, aggregators, platforms, payment providers, legal and financial services
  • Lotteries
  • Financial and investment funds
  • CFTC-regulated prediction markets
  • Crypto providers

Clients across Europe, North America and Middle East.

You sell, we build

You never make a deliverable. Editorial writes the content, designers build the assets, developers run the site. You get a sales CRM, decks, and whatever tool setup you want, configured for you.

The wider team carries the rest: content, design, site development, new media brands in iGaming and fintech, and relations with regulators, associations, trade bodies and government tenders.

Pay

Commission on every invoice you generate, paid monthly, with no cap. New deals, rebookings and upsells all pay the same rate. You keep earning on the accounts for as long as your contract with us runs.

Realistic first-year earnings are 70,000 to 100,000 euros, with no ceiling above that.

After a strong first year, measured against sales targets we agree when you sign, you’re offered equity in the company. This is a partner track.

What we’re looking for

You know how iGaming works and how deals get done in it: who buys, who signs, how trust is built between operators, suppliers and executives. You already have those relationships, or you can build them.

You post on LinkedIn, or you at least read it closely enough to know how iGaming media moves there.

Direct experience selling iGaming media is not required. The network and the feel for the industry matter more than a media CV.

Comfort with AI tools (LLMs and AI agents) in your workflow is a plus. If you don’t have it, we’ll teach you.

We give visibility back. We publish articles with you and put your name in front of our full readership.

Terms

Own company or self-employed. Fully remote, anywhere in Europe or North America. No fixed schedule, no mandatory meetings, no reporting rituals. You’re measured on what you close. 3-month notice period. iGaming-media exclusivity: you don’t represent competing media brands.

How to apply

Send your LinkedIn profile. Drop us a line if writing is your style. If it isn’t, we’ll talk on the phone.

No resumes. No forms. No cover letters. We’re a LinkedIn-first brand and we hire like one.
